The Rich History of Beer: From Ancient Brews to Modern Workmanship



Although beer has developed considerably over centuries, its beginnings can be traced back to old human beings that uncovered the fermentation process. Proof suggests that the Sumerians, around 5,000 BCE, brewed a rudimentary form of beer, developing it as a staple in their culture. The Egyptians later improved developing techniques, integrating various grains and tastes. Throughout background, beer ended up being a communal beverage, representing friendliness and event. The Center Ages saw the surge of monasteries as facilities of brewing, causing the advancement of distinct designs. With the Industrial Revolution, mass production changed beer into an international asset. Today, the craft beer motion highlights conventional methods and cutting-edge flavors, showing a deep gratitude for beer's rich heritage while accepting modern creative thinking.

White wine varietals showcase an exceptional diversity, showing the unique attributes of the grapes used in their production. Each varietal has unique taste structures, fragrances, and accounts, influenced by the grape's environment, winery, and origin techniques. Cabernet Sauvignon is commemorated for its bold framework and abundant flavors of black currant and oak, while Pinot Noir is known for its elegance and delicate notes of cherry and planet. Chardonnay, a versatile white, can range from crisp and minerally to buttery and velvety, relying on its vinification. Exploring these varietals enables lovers to appreciate the subtleties of terroir and winemaking methods, boosting their total tasting experience and understanding of this complicated beverage.


The Art of Distillation: Understanding Liquor Manufacturing



The detailed process of distillation plays a vital function in the production of alcohol, transforming fermented active ingredients into high-proof spirits. This method entails heating a fermented fluid, permitting the alcohol to vaporize, and afterwards condensing it back into fluid kind (THC seltzer near me). The secret to efficient purification hinges on the splitting up of alcohol from water and various other elements, which needs precision and control over temperature. Various sorts of stills, such as pot stills and column stills, influence the end product's personality. Distillers commonly carry out numerous rounds of distillation to boost purity and taste. Eventually, the art of purification not just protects the essence of the original active ingredients however also boosts the taste profile, developing a diverse variety of spirits taken pleasure in worldwide


Combining Food and Beverages: Elevating Your Eating Experience



When it concerns eating, the best pairing of food and beverages can greatly improve the overall experience. Specialist pairings can raise flavors, developing a harmonious balance on the taste. For circumstances, a crisp white wine matches fish and shellfish, while a bold merlot can improve the splendor of red meats. Beer supplies flexibility, with pale ales matching well with spicy recipes, and stouts boosting chocolate treats. Furthermore, spirits can add an appealing measurement; gin's botanicals may highlight fresh herbs in a recipe. Comprehending the concepts of acidity, sweetness, and appearance aids restaurants make notified selections. Ultimately, thoughtful pairings not only enhance preference however also create unforgettable culinary experiences, allowing guests to appreciate the art of gastronomy completely.


Exploring International Drinking Cultures and Traditions





Culinary experiences are deeply intertwined with the customs of alcohol consumption across numerous cultures. In several societies, beverages serve not just as beverages yet as indispensable elements of rituals and celebrations. In Japan, sake is frequently appreciated during events and ceremonies, representing regard and consistency. In Mexico, tequila is commemorated with vivid social celebrations, reflecting the country's abundant heritage. Similarly, in Germany, beer takes center phase throughout Oktoberfest, showcasing regional developing practices. Each society has one-of-a-kind practices surrounding drinking, from toasting customizeds to the significance of local ingredients. These traditions promote community, boost cooking experiences, and offer understanding right into the worths and history of each society, showing the extensive duty that beverages play in cultural identification.

Proper Glasses Choice



Just how can the best glass wares enhance the sampling experience of spirits? Selecting suitable glassware is essential for fully appreciating the nuances of numerous spirits. Different kinds of glasses are designed to highlight certain features of the drink. A tulip-shaped glass concentrates scents, making it perfect for whiskies and brandies. Beer near me. On the other hand, a broad bowl glass is much better fit for cocktails, permitting for a more comprehensive surface to blend components. Furthermore, the product and thickness of the glass can influence temperature and mouthfeel. Making use of crystal or premium glass can raise the experience, as it commonly mirrors light wonderfully and includes a component of class. Ultimately, the best glass enhances both the aesthetic and tactile pleasure of spirits


Aroma and Taste Analysis



Fragrance and flavor play vital duties in the recognition of spirits, and mastering their assessment can elevate one's sampling experience. Assessing scent starts with a mild swirl of the glass, which launches unpredictable compounds. A deep breathing enables for the identification of numerous notes, such as fruity, spicy, or natural characteristics. Taste assessment includes taking a little sip and allowing the spirit layer the taste, disclosing its complexity. The initial preference, mid-palate subtleties, and sticking around coating give understanding right into the spirit's quality and workmanship. It is crucial to continue to be mindful of personal predispositions, permitting an objective evaluation. Documenting impacts can assist in establishing a refined taste, improving future samplings and cultivating a deeper gratitude for the art of purification.

What Is the Difference Between ABV and Evidence in Alcohol?



The difference in between ABV (Alcohol by Volume) and evidence exists in dimension. ABV suggests the portion of alcohol in a beverage, while evidence is twice the ABV percent, giving a relative toughness analysis balcones whiskey of alcoholic drinks.
